10-Minute Blackberry Simple Syrup
This blackberry simple syrup blends fresh or frozen blackberries with sugar and water, simmered to release the fruit's color and flavor. The syrup offers a vibrant purple hue and a balanced sweetness that can be brightened with lemon juice if desired. It's a practical syrup for sweetening drinks or desserts and can be stored refrigerated for up to two weeks.
Ingredients
- 6 ounces blackberry or frozen, fresh
- ¾ cup granulated sugar
- ¾ cup water
- lemon juice optional, fresh
Instructions
- Clean the blackberries well (if using fresh) in a bath of salt water or vinegar. Rinse well.
- In a small saucepan, combine sugar, water, and blackberries. Heat over medium-high heat until simmering, stirring occasionally. Once softened, gently smash the softened berries with the back of a spoon or masher. Simmer for 6-8 minutes until the berries have disintegrated into seeds and the syrup is bright purple.
- Remove from heat and strain out the berries and seeds through a fine-mesh sieve. Use a spoon to stir the mixture to release the syrup as needed, being careful to not let any seeds or fruit bits into the syrup. Discard the seeds.
- Optional: stir in a squeeze of fresh lemon juice to bring out the berry flavor if it's tasting flat; it's not about adding lemon flavor but rather enhancing the blackberry notes.
- Let cool as needed and use immediately or store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 weeks.
Notes
- The recipe yields just over 1 cup of syrup, suitable for multiple uses.
- Frozen blackberries can be used directly without thawing; simmer longer if needed.
- Adjust sugar to taste, especially with less sweet frozen berries.
- Use a 3/4 sugar to water ratio for a more intense blackberry flavor or increase both equally to make more syrup with milder taste.
